本文不作全面综述,而是为机器人领域的世界模型与世界行动模型提供一份简明教程。读者阅读后将清晰理解何为“世界”、世界模型与世界行动模型的定义及其在机器人人工智能系统中的角色。教程还建立了一个统一视角,用于对比代表性方法:World Labs的空间智能模型、Yann LeCun的JEPA框架以及NVIDIA的Cosmos平台,并阐明这些模型在表征方式、预测能力与交互机制上的异同。

Rather than providing an exhaustive survey, this paper presents a concise tutorial on world models and world action models for robotics. After reading the tutorial, readers should have a clear understanding of what constitutes a "world", how world models and world action models are defined, and what roles they play within robotic AI systems. The tutorial also develops a unified perspective for comparing representative approaches, such as World Labs' spatial intelligence models, Yann LeCun's JEPA framework, and NVIDIA's Cosmos platform, and clarifies how these models differ in their representations, predictive capabilities, and interaction mechanisms.
